Climax-Scotts dropped down to 6-2 on Friday, ending the team's six-game streak of wins. They lost 46-20 to the Mendon Hornets. The contest marked the Panthers' lowest-scoring matchup so far this season.

As for Mendon, the victory keeps them at an undefeated 8-0. The wins came thanks in part to their defensive effort, having only surrendered 11.1 points on average this season.

It was another big night for Owen Gorham, who rushed for 242 yards and four TDs while picking up 10.5 yards per carry. His rushing production has been exceptional as that marked his seventh straight game with at least 102 rushing yards. The team also got some help courtesy of James T Lux, who rushed for 111 yards and one touchdown on only 13 carries.

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Climax-Scotts will venture away from home to challenge Pittsford at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. The Panthers will need to watch out since the Wildcats have now posted at least 31 points in their last seven matchups. As for Mendon, they are taking a road trip to take on Lenawee Christian at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. The Hornets will need to watch out since the Cougars have now posted at least 31 points in their last three contests.
